Haeundae Blueline Park

Haeundae Blue Line Park is one of the most scenic and underrated attractions in Busan. It takes you along the coastline on a beautiful journey using two unique options: the colorful Busan Sky Capsule or the faster Beach Train. Whether you're riding above the sea or walking the trails, you're in for sweeping views of the East Sea, clear blue water, and a peaceful escape from the city. Opened in 2020, this former railway line has quickly become a must-visit spot in Busan.

Gamcheon Culture Village

Discover the vibrant and colorful Gamcheon Culture village in Busan, South Korea, known for its artistic and cultural charm. Famous for its maze-like alleys, brightly painted houses, and unique murals and art installations created by local artists, Gamcheon Culture Village is often referred to as the "Santorini of Korea" or the "Machu Picchu of Busan". Originally built in the 1950s as a place where refugees settled during the Korean War, Gamcheon culture village has since been transformed into a popular tourist destination. Public art projects, including sculptures, street paintings, and interactive exhibits, have revitalized the area, making it a hub for photographers and art lovers.

Haedong Yonggung Temple

Haedong Yonggungsa Temple is one of the most impressive temples in South Korea, nestled along the scenic coastline of northeastern Busan. With a history spanning over 600 years from the Goryeo dynasty, Haedong Yonggungsa Temple has remained a cherished symbol of Korean Buddhist heritage. After reaching the 108 stairs through the pine grove, visitors are greeted with its awe-inspiring architecture, crashing waves, and serene sea breezes, all while soaking in panoramic ocean views. Perched majestically on cliffs overlooking the azure waters, its main sanctuary is adorned with a three-story pagoda featuring four lions. With its spiritual solace, breathtaking architecture, and natural surroundings, Haedong Yonggungsa Temple invites visitors to embrace a moment of peace and tranquility along the shoreline of Busan. Gwangalli Beach

Gwangalli Beach, a 1.4-kilometer-long sandy cove to the west of Haeundae Beach, is famous for its fine sand. This spot is not only one of Busan's top beaches but also a hub for food, drinks, and fun in South Korea. With a mix of traditional temples, waterfront parks, exciting festivals, and dazzling drone shows, there's something for everyone at Gwangalli Beach, perfect for soaking up the sun!

Haeundae Beach

Haeundae Beach, located in Busan, South Korea, is a must-visit attraction for locals and tourists alike. With its 1.5 km of white sandy shoreline, it's a top summer spot, attracting over 10 million visitors each year. This famous urban beach offers a beautiful coast and shallow bay for swimming, alongside luxury hotels, cozy guesthouses, and exciting cultural festivals including the Haeundae Sand Festival, Busan Sea Festival, and Haeundae Lights Festival. Busan Tower

Experience the vibrant city of Busan, South Korea, a bustling metropolis that offers a unique blend of modernity and tradition. From the stunning cherry blossoms to the bustling markets and historical landmarks, Busan has something for every traveler seeking an unforgettable adventure. Explore the breathtaking views of Busan from the iconic Busan Tower, a 120-meter-high tower located in Yongdusan Park. Built in 1973 for entertainment purposes, this tower offers a panoramic view of the city's port and features a cozy cafe at the top. Discover the cultural and historical significance of Busan Tower while enjoying the various galleries and souvenir shops at the base of the tower for a memorable experience in Busan.

Huinnyeoul Culture Village

Discover the enchanting coastal charm of Huinnyeoul Culture Village in Busan, a hidden gem nestled on the sloping cliffs of Yeongdo. This picturesque village has transformed from a refuge for Korean War survivors into a vibrant culture and art hub, reminiscent of Santorini in Greece. With its stunning views, unique shops, and colorful murals, Huinnyeoul Culture Village offers a delightful escape for travelers seeking a blend of history and creativity.

BUSAN X the SKY

Experience the breathtaking views of Busan from the top of BUSAN X the SKY observatory, located on the 98th, 99th, and 100th floors of Haeundae LCT The Sharp - Landmark Tower. Discover the tallest building in Busan and the stunning landmarks that make this observatory a must-visit destination. BUSAN X the SKY is also home to the highest Starbucks in the world, offering a unique blend of coffee and panoramic views that will leave you in awe. Opened in 2020, this hidden gem provides a truly unforgettable experience that will elevate your travel experience to new heights. As the largest observatory in Korea, BUSAN X the SKY offers a unique blend of Sea Side View and City View, showcasing Busan's famous landmarks and stunning landscapes.
